Automotive Artificial Intelligence Voice: Revolutionizing the In-Cabin Experience

Research suggests that automotive artificial intelligence voice is rapidly emerging as the new frontier for in-vehicle interaction, evolving from simple command execution to a sophisticated, conversational AI assistant that personalizes the entire driving experience. The automotive artificial intelligence voice segment is a key driver of the digital cockpit revolution, with the market for AI-powered automotive assistants projected to grow from approximately $7.1 billion in 2025 at a CAGR of over 22% through 2035 . This growth reflects a fundamental shift as vehicles transition to software-defined platforms, making the voice AI agent the primary interface between driver and car .

Traditional voice systems that respond only to fixed commands are being replaced by advanced, LLM-based conversational agents. These new assistants can maintain context across exchanges, handle multi-intent commands, and understand the location of the speaker within the cabin . For instance, a driver can say “I’m feeling cold,” and the system intelligently activates seat heating and adjusts climate control without needing separate commands . Companies are integrating advanced platforms, such as Google Gemini, enabling a more natural, conversational dialogue, while others are developing systems that can coordinate multiple actions from a single request, like "play a movie and share my screen" . This evolution is turning the vehicle cabin into a responsive, personalized environment where AI can orchestrate everything from climate and lighting to navigation and infotainment.

A critical trend in automotive voice AI is the shift from cloud-dependent to edge processing. While the cloud offers powerful computing, it introduces latency, fails in connectivity dead zones (like tunnels and remote areas), raises per-vehicle operational costs, and creates privacy concerns . Leading OEMs like Mercedes-Benz and Hyundai are actively developing on-device voice AI agents that can function reliably offline . This move is enabled by optimization techniques like model compression, allowing sophisticated language models to run on vehicle hardware with minimal memory footprint—some solutions achieving total RAM footprints under 500MB . As the automotive artificial intelligence market continues to mature, this shift toward on-device, context-aware voice AI will make the in-vehicle experience more intuitive, responsive, and private, solidifying the AI agent as the central hub for vehicle interaction.
